Write the coefficient of $x^{2}$ in the following polynomial:
$7 x^{3}-11 x+24$

(0) In the polynomial $7 x^{3}-11 x+24$,the term containing $x^{2}$ is not present.
This can be written as $7 x^{3} + 0x^{2} - 11 x + 24$.
Therefore,the coefficient of $x^{2}$ is $0$.
